Clapham High Street station simplifies ticketing with accessible ticket machines ready for use. Though there isn’t a traditional ticket office, purchasing and collecting tickets online is straightforward and convenient. Smartcards are not issued here, so ensure to have valid tickets beforehand. While the station provides visible customer help points and information screens, it's important to note that there are no staffed helplines at the station.
Accessibility is somewhat limited at Clapham High Street with Category C classification, indicating no step-free access. Also, there are no accessible toilets or ramps for train access. While seating is available on both platforms, waiting rooms and lounges are absent, meaning you'll want to plan your stay accordingly when traveling.
Clapham High Street is a utilitarian station, and as such, lacks facilities like refreshment areas, shops, or public Wi-Fi. However, its strategic location offers excellent external amenities. The station is enveloped by an array of local cafes and shops, perfect for preparing for your journey or grabbing a quick bite.
For those needing to continue their journey beyond the station, there are several transport links. Bus stops nearby provide easy connectivity, with routes available for both southbound and northbound services. You're conveniently located a mere three-minute walk from Clapham North London Underground station if you need an underground ride on the Northern line. Additionally, you can organize taxi services in advance through reliable platforms like Addison Lee and Gett.

Minster station is equipped with ticket machines that cater to online ticket collections, making the preparation for your journey seamless. While the station does not have a ticket office, the presence of accessible ticket machines, conveniently positioned by the entrance to platform 2, makes it easy for everyone, including those with accessibility needs, to secure their train tickets. Though there is no luggage storage, waiting rooms, or refreshment options, the station still manages to provide essential services. You'll find customer help points available to ensure your questions are answered, and a helpline is at hand for any additional support.
Regarding accessibility, Minster station has partial step-free access under category B1. You can expect step-free travel towards London via a railway foot crossing. While not staffed, help from Southeastern's mobile assistance team can be arranged in advance for those needing additional support. Although there are no dedicated station staff, assistance is available directly on the trains, promising smooth boarding and disembarking.
For those who wish to explore beyond the local area, Minster station's convenient transport links are sure to please. The rail replacement service and buses can be accessed from the car park at the front of the station, providing alternatives during service disruptions.
